Reminder: Policy Changes

This is a reminder that the Operating Committees of HEALTHeLINK and HEALTHeNET have approved revisions to their respective Privacy and Security Policies and Procedures, effective December 23, 2024.


This Notice is given pursuant to Sections 2.3, 3.4, and 3.5 of the HEALTHeLINK Participation Agreement Terms & Conditions and the Data Recipient Agreement Terms & Conditions for HEALTHeNET, which require 30 days' notice to all Participants prior to the effective date of any changes.


HEALTHeLINK Revisions (Effective December 23, 2024)

Glossary Updates: Aligning with SHIN-NY definitions.

New Additions:

  • Statewide Consent Date
  • Statewide Form of Consent

P03 Authorized User Access:

  • Participants must verify the identity of their Authorized Users.
  • HEALTHeLINK must verify the identity of their personnel.
  • Community-Based Organizations (CBOs) not subject to HIPAA can access patient data with affirmative consent and minimum necessary standards.

P04 Patient Consent:

  • Clarification that PHI can be shared with the Department of Health (DOH) without affirmative consent for certain purposes.
  • Technical changes to accommodate the upcoming Statewide Consent initiative.


HEALTHeNET Revisions (Effective December 23, 2024)

P01 Authorized User Access:

  • Data Suppliers/Data Recipients must verify the identity of their Authorized Users.
  • HEALTHeNET must verify the identity of their personnel.

TEFCA (Trusted Exchange Framework and Common Agreement) is a government-endorsed initiative for nationwide health data sharing. It launched at the end of 2023, allowing Qualified Health Information Networks (QHINs) to exchange data securely under common standards.

CIVITAS Annual Conference

HEALTHeLINK took center stage on a number of panels at the CIVITAS Conference in October, showcasing our innovative work and associated value to our community. Notably, the organization was honored with the prestigious 'Innovation Pioneer Award' for its groundbreaking work on the HEALTHeWNY Dashboard. This recognition, presented at the Civitas Networks for Health Community Excellence Awards ceremony, is a testament to our team’s dedication in bringing HEALTHeWNY to life and we are grateful for the support and utilization from the WNY community.

Dan Porreca, Karen Craik, and Pastor Nicholas led an insightful panel discussion on Health Equity, the merger of PHC and the HEALTHeWNY Dashboard.

Jillian Greenbaum was part of a panel discussion on CMS, HIE, & Public Health Partnerships to Drive Value-Based Care Transformation.

HIE Platform Migration – Fusion Project

HEALTHeLINK is advancing its priority project to migrate to a new Health Information Exchange (HIE) platform. In alignment with the SHIN-NY’s shared infrastructure initiative, HEALTHeLINK has joined the Advancing Shared Infrastructure Consortium, which includes HealtheConnections, Rochester RHIO, Bronx RHIO, and Tech by Design. Over the past several months, the Consortium has conducted a thorough evaluation and selected a new HIE platform system. HEALTHeLINK will be the first Qualified Entity (QE) within the Consortium to transition to the chosen Fusion product.

Catholic Health System - Sleep Studies

As of August 26, 2024, Catholic Health System (CHS) has successfully integrated sleep studies, pulmonary function tests (PFTs), and electromyograms (EMGs) into their transcribed reports shared with HEALTHeLINK. This advancement marks a significant achievement in streamlining and enhancing the accessibility of critical health data through the highly regarded Health Information Exchange.

ADOPTION

Percent of WNY practices who participate with HEALTHeLINK: 87%

 

Total number of patient consent forms signed: 1,601,993.

 

Total results available through HEALTHeLINK: 398,927,646.


Total number of patient record look up queries in HEALTHeLINK YTD:5,090,395

 

Total number of practices sending data to HEALTHeLINK from their EHR: 580

 

Total number of practices getting results delivered from HEALTHeLINK into their EHR:753
